Output 95fbc3ce57fc707b13055d980e5c4bfe197a36df9787b0687f3621042a56f662:0

value
3524301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bcc66f86261b9bbc6600226b72d7eba15be41a OP_EQUAL
address
37EAcP1Ec54VRrQ8MohUDj6yVbD8uQDQYH
transaction
95fbc3ce57fc707b13055d980e5c4bfe197a36df9787b0687f3621042a56f662
spent
true